Magician's Reprise!

Those bewildering thoughts,

Ready to pounce out,

I caress them all throughout,

Only to not let them be camouflaged,

For they are quite profound!


As unusual as it may sound, 

Glorifying its glory,

Does leave me weary,

Sure! It's a task,

Asking me to wear a mask!


Hovering all day,

Tugging me towards them,

I struggle to toss them away,

Until I conjure them,

By penning those gems!!
